Samsung Starts Production of Displays for Apple's Foldable iPhone In a significant development within the tech industry, Samsung Display has officially commenced the mass production of OLED modules for Apple's highly anticipated first foldable iPhone. This milestone marks a pivotal collaboration between two of the world's leading technology firms, with the production taking place at Samsung's facility located in Vietnam. Key Developments Initial Order: Apple has placed an initial order for 3 million OLED panels intended for delivery within this calendar year. Production Yield: Impressively, the production yield for these panels has exceeded 80%, surpassing Apple's requirement of 70% efficiency. Exclusive Supply Agreement: Samsung has secured a three-year exclusive supply contract with Apple for the provision of these displays. Technological Advancements: The OLED panels feature Cutting-edge Emissive (CoE) and M16 OLED technology, which ensure that the displays are thinner and more energy-efficient than their predecessors. The Hinge Module: A Critical Variable While the screen production is progressing well, a crucial aspect that remains uncertain is the hinge module, which is essential for the device's foldable design. Reports suggest that issues relating to the hinge could potentially impact the overall timeline for the product launch. While an early release is still within the realm of possibility, with a target around September 2026, analysts are cautiously suggesting that a later debut may be more realistic. As such, industry watchers are keeping a keen eye on developments regarding the hinge mechanism. Samsung Electronics Faces Patent Lawsuit from Tau Ceti Samsung Electronics is currently embroiled in a significant legal battle following a patent infringement lawsuit filed by Tau Ceti in the United States. The lawsuit's focal point involves several popular devices, notably the highly anticipated Galaxy S25 smartphone and the advanced Watch8 smartwatch. The Allegations Tau Ceti, a firm known for its innovations in the realm of display technologies, alleges that Samsung has infringed upon its patented technologies aimed at improving LED displays. This legal action raises critical questions about innovation, intellectual property rights, and the competitive landscape within the tech industry. Devices Under Scrutiny The following devices have been specifically named in the lawsuit: Galaxy S25 Watch8 Other unnamed devices potentially utilizing similar display technology. The Impact on Samsung As one of the leading electronics manufacturers globally, Samsung's reputation and financial standing could be significantly affected by the outcome of this lawsuit. Patent disputes in the tech industry can be lengthy and costly, often leading to unfavorable settlements or modifications of product designs. Apple's Price Hike Warning: A Closer Look at Tim Cook's Concerns In a recent announcement, Apple CEO Tim Cook raised eyebrows in the tech community by suggesting that consumers may face price increases on some Apple devices. This potential shift comes amid a growing shortage of memory chips, essential components found in a wide range of electronics. The Root of the Problem: Memory Chip Shortages The underlying issue revolves around the semiconductor industry, wherein chip manufacturers are redirecting their production resources. Increasingly, these companies are prioritizing manufacturing for artificial intelligence (AI) servers and data-center infrastructure, which are gaining significant traction in today’s digital landscape. This shift has inevitably led to a reduced supply of chips available for consumer electronics. As demand continues to rise for products utilizing AI technologies, the competition for semiconductor resources intensifies, leaving less available for traditional devices such as smartphones and laptops. Apple’s Strategic Response In response to these challenges, Apple has opted for a strategy that involves securing long-term supply agreements with memory chip manufacturers across the globe. Rather than embarking on a costly endeavor of constructing its own memory factories, Apple aims to build solid partnerships with existing chipmakers. However, there is a significant layer of complexity surrounding these agreements. Some of the deals may require oversight and approval from U.S. regulators, largely fueled by national security concerns tied to the semiconductor supply chain. Uncertainty Ahead: Which Devices Will Be Affected? Despite the alarming forecast, Apple has yet to pinpoint specific devices that might see price hikes. The lack of transparency regarding which products could be impacted adds another layer of uncertainty, not only for consumers but also for businesses that rely on Apple's devices for daily operations. Apple Radically Restructures Mac Chip Roadmap, Skipping M6 Pro and Max Variants In a strategic shift that marks one of the most significant changes in its silicon history, Apple is reportedly restructuring its Mac chip development roadmap, eliminating the traditional Pro and Max variants for the upcoming M6 generation while accelerating its timeline for future AI-focused processors. Breaking with Tradition: The End of the M6 Pro and Max According to sources familiar with Apple's plans reported by Bloomberg's Mark Gurman, the company will launch the base M6 chip later this year in a departure from its established pattern. For the first time since introducing the M1 family, Apple will not release corresponding Pro and Max variants of the M6 architecture. This unprecedented decision signals a major strategic pivot for Apple's silicon division, which has consistently followed a tiered approach with each chip generation. Previously, Apple has released base, Pro, Max, and Ultra variants of each architecture, allowing for precise differentiation across its product lineup from entry-level MacBook Air to high-end Mac Studio and Mac Pro models. The Final M5 Ultra: A Grand Finale Before transitioning to the M6 architecture, Apple plans to release one final M5 chip later this year: the M5 Ultra. This high-end processor is expected to represent the pinnacle of Apple's current silicon capabilities, featuring: Up to 36 CPU cores 80 GPU cores Support for as much as 768GB of unified memory The M5 Ultra is anticipated to be Apple's most powerful chip to date, potentially finding its way into the top-tier Mac Studio and Mac Pro models, cementing the M5 generation as a significant milestone in Apple's silicon journey.
